Some exercises to do at home

Straighten the spine and the pelvic area. Sit on the floor, feet up and parallel, spine straight and inhale and let your belly expand. Exhale by tightening the pelvic area (as if you had the urge to urinate or experienced bowel movement) for 3 seconds and then relax it for 5 seconds. Repeat this exercise for 1 to 5 minutes once a day.
Tone the thighs, buttocks and perineum. Keep the feet slightly apart and parallel, the shoulders down, the neck stretched and keep a soft ball or cushion between your knees. Contract your gluteal muscles and then lower your back. Repeat this exercise by contracting the pelvic area and squeezing the ball.

Relieve the perineum. Keep a pillow under your head, slightly raise the pelvis and place a rolled towel under your buttocks so that the perineum is facing up. Close your eyes and enjoy this moment of relaxation.
You can also use a large Swiss ball for the relaxation exercises. Keep your legs on the ball.

The Purpose of a Dog Health Insurance

Animal health insurance - 75 percent of dogs and 88 percent of cat lovers have never been closer to the subject of animal health insurance. This is the finding of a study conducted by the market research firm GfK in 2011.


There is still much unmet demand, which can be covered with new products. This is the conclusion of the insurer. There are some providers such as Agila that have specialized in dog health insurance. In the end, most dog owners wonder what the purpose of this type of insurance is.

Costs with health insurance

Here is a concrete example: a not so common stomach-turning surgery on a Golden Retriever is estimated at 2000 EUR. Then, detoxification after rat poison ingestion costs about 540 EUR. Also, dogs often suffer injuries after colliding with motorists. Chronic diseases are also quite costly. A simple calculation shows that a full dog insurance policy with 20 percent equity participation starts at 27 EUR a month for dogs and 15 EUR a month for cats. The costs may reach 42 EUR, depending on the breed, age and coverage areas.


According to the same study, every seventh dog had already undergone surgery. This is an impressive number, but there is no way to assess the type of operation and its costs. The study also pointed out also that the vet fees had increased by twelve percent as compared to the previous year.

The City of Sin Will Soon Arrive in Europe

The situation in Las Vegas is far from rosy at the moment. The number of players has decreased considerably and the Chinese gambling Mecca Macau has outrun the heart of gambling in Nevada already.

Vegas is expected to have to face another competitor called Europe in the next years. In concrete terms, the Euro Vegas Casino at the border between Hungary and Austria promises to have a significant say. Of course, it will not cover the wide range of opportunities as Las Vegas casinos, but it will still have a consistent and attractive offer. This unique entertainment center will cover an area of 335 hectares. There will be this huge "event center" with a surface of 5,000 square meters, more than 630 hotel rooms, a huge spa center, restaurants and bars and a number of gambling venues. One of them will house 3,000 machines and 200 tables.

This mega project costs almost five billion Euros. The choice of the location of this rip-off casino could not be more inspired. It will be located at the crossroads of the railway road and the highway and has a separate exit. The project also includes a railway station, which will be built in the next few years.

The location of this casino is the best as Bratislava is 35 kilometers away, Vienna is 77 km away and Budapest is 171 km away. There are also two international airports nearby.

DLP versus LCD

Today, both technologies hold the upper hand and compete against each other. Each camp has its ardent defenders. DLP supporters pledge for "deep black", "more intense colors" and "better color fastness over time", while supporters of the LCD technology respond with "the no rainbow effect", "more color thus better degradation" and "finer overall appearance".

Here is the bottom line: Choose the DLP technology if you are sensitive to the rainbow effect. If you are not, choose between the two types of technology according to your tastes. No current technology can satisfy all customers.

HD Ready Definition versus Full HD

An HD ready video projector displays at least 720 lines, while a full HD projector displays at least 1,080 lines. 1,080 lines is precisely the definition used by the HDTV and Blu-ray. Therefore, you should opt for this type of projector to enjoy the quality of HD!

1,080 line projectors are recommended, especially since they are very affordable now. The models with a definition of 720 lines tend to disappear gradually.

Should you believe what the manufacturers say?

You can simply ignore the contrast figures announced by manufacturers. They are calculated as to maximize the contrast but they are far from the ideal conditions in which you should watch a movie. For example, the contrast of a projector of 80,000:1 falls to about 500 to 1000:1 once all the settings have been made. Rely on your own measurements instead because it is safer.
